Gladys Morcom
Gladys Morcom (31 October 1918 – 18 January 2010) was a British swimmer. She competed in the women's 400 metre freestyle at the 1936 Summer Olympics.[1] She also competed at the 1934 British Empire Games. She married Basil Lees in 1958 and became Gladys Lees and died in 2010.[2]
